Weather update: Karachi to experience cold day and night

The Pakistan Meteorological Department said on Wednesday that Karachi will experience dry weather over the next 24 hours with cold winds and a chilly night.

A minimum temperature of 11 degrees Celsius was recorded by the MET department with 59% humidity.

According to the details, the temperature in the metropolis is expected to fall even further as the weather of the port city is influence by Quetta’s severe cold weather.

The PMD said that Northeast winds at a speed of 18 kilometers per hour are blowing in Karachi.

It should be mentioned here that on Tuesday, the temperature in Quetta fell to -9 degrees Celsius and many cities across Balochistan have been gripped in cold since the beginning of December.

On Tuesday, the met officials said Kalat recorded -11 degrees Celsius, Sibi 6 degrees Celsius while Turbat and Gwadar experienced 9 degrees Celsius.
